ABSTRACT

The introduction of the Directive 2010/31/EU has stimulated innovative advances in the domain of nearly-zero energy building retrofits and several performance-based solutions relating to the retrofit of building façades. Façade is a critical area of intervention in deep building retrofits. Façade designers, engineers and/or architects must emphasise on and render customised retrofit solutions for varied building types and focus on more than just achieving low-energy consumption buildings. Façades are the prime face of interaction and have deep visual and functional impact on the built environment. It is essential to investigate and review the current trends and focus parameters of façade retrofits by examining the state-of-art research on retrofits. The goal of this study is to establish a brief repository for the building professionals, to inform the current state-of-art and modernisation trends. Thus, it aims at developing fundamental aspects of façade retrofit practices towards achieving better quality nearly zero-energy buildings.
